The case comes two days after the Ugandan parliament called for Mr Kutesa, as well as the country’s prime minister, Amama Mbabazi, and internal affairs minister Hilary Onek, to step down while it investigated allegations that the Anglo-Irish oil company Tullow Oil paid millions of dollars in bribes to them and other officials in exchange for concessions in the East African nation’s oil fields.
